Heat Reduction And Energy Efficiency
Heat reduction plays a crucial role in improving vehicle comfort. Quality window tint can lower cabin temperatures by up to 60%. This reduction leads to less strain on the air conditioning system, resulting in increased energy efficiency. By decreasing the need for cooling, we save fuel and minimize our carbon footprint.
UV Protection For Interiors
UV protection serves as a vital benefit of window tint. Quality films can block up to 99% of harmful UV rays. This protection preserves the interior materials and prevents fading. Additionally, minimizing UV exposure enhances the health of passengers by reducing the risk of skin damage linked to sun exposure.

Type of Window Tint Available
Different types of window tints offer various benefits. We can choose from:
- Dyed Window Tint: Provides a sleek appearance and reduces glare without reflecting heat. It’s cost-effective but may fade over time.
- Metalized Window Tint: Contains metal particles that enhance heat rejection and provide extra strength. The metallic finish can interfere with electronic signals.
- Ceramic Window Tint: Offers superior heat and UV protection without reflective properties. It’s more expensive but lasts longer and maintains clarity.
- Hybrid Window Tint: Combines dyed and metalized films, providing a balance of aesthetics and performance. This option generally offers moderate heat rejection at a reasonable cost.
Installation Process And Considerations
The installation process significantly affects the longevity and performance of window tint. We should consider:
- Professional Installation: Professionals ensure that the film is applied correctly, minimizing bubbles and imperfections.
- DIY Installation: This option can save money but requires precision. Mistakes can lead to peeling or poor visibility.
- Curing Time: Newly installed tints require a curing period before exposure to moisture or rolling down windows. This waiting period varies by film type.
- Local Regulations: Regulations dictate the allowed tint percentages and reflectivity. We must verify these rules to avoid legal issues.
Cost And Budgeting For Window Tint
Budgeting for window tint involves several components. We should factor in:
- Types of Films: Prices vary based on tint type, with ceramic films usually being the most expensive and dyed films the least.
- Installation Fees: Professional installation typically adds to the overall cost, ranging from $100 to $300 depending on the film type and vehicle size.
- Maintenance: Regular care can extend the tint’s life, but we may incur minor costs for cleaning and upkeep.
